Practical Steps to Pray Effectively for a Narcissist

Praying for someone with narcissistic tendencies can be delicate. Here are practical steps to guide your prayer life:

  • Begin with Personal Reflection and Repentance
  • Start by examining your own heart. Pray for humility, patience, and love. Seek God's forgiveness for any judgments or bitterness you may harbor. This sets a spiritual foundation to pray effectively and compassionately.

  • Pray for Their Spiritual Awakening
  • Ask God to open their eyes to their true nature and to reveal His love and truth to them. Pray that they recognize their need for humility and a genuine relationship with Christ.

  • Request Divine Transformation
  • Pray that the Holy Spirit works within their heart to bring about genuine change. Ask God to soften their pride, replace selfishness with empathy, and cultivate humility and kindness.

  • Pray for Wisdom and Discernment
  • Request wisdom for yourself to handle interactions wisely and prayerfully. Pray for discernment to recognize unhealthy patterns and to respond in love rather than frustration.

  • Pray for Patience and Endurance
  • Transforming a narcissist's heart is a process that requires patience. Pray for God’s strength to endure the difficult moments and to maintain a spirit of grace.

  • Pray for Your Own Peace and Boundaries
  • While praying for the narcissist, also pray for your emotional and spiritual well-being. Ask God to grant you peace, wisdom in setting healthy boundaries, and protection from manipulation or harm.


Sample Prayer for a Narcissist

Here is a prayer template you can adapt and personalize:

Heavenly Father, I come before You with a heart full of love and concern. I pray for [name], that You would reveal Your truth and love to them. Lord, I ask that You soften their heart, remove pride and selfishness, and replace it with humility and compassion. Transform their mind and spirit, so they may come to know You more deeply. Give me wisdom, patience, and grace as I navigate this relationship. Protect me from harm, and fill me with Your peace. I trust in Your power to change lives, including theirs. In Jesus’ name, I pray. Amen.


Building a Spirit-Led Prayer Routine

Consistency in prayer is vital. Consider establishing a daily or weekly prayer routine dedicated to praying for the narcissist. Use a prayer journal to track your prayers, noting any insights or changes you observe. Incorporate Scripture reading related to humility, love, and transformation to deepen your prayers.

Some helpful scriptures include:

  • Romans 12:2 – “Be transformed by the renewing of your mind.”
  • 2 Corinthians 3:17 – “Where the Spirit of the Lord is, there is freedom.”
  • Luke 6:27-28 – “Love your enemies, do good to those who hate you.”
  • Matthew 5:44 – “Pray for those who persecute you.”
